How does TEA affect neurons?

Transient K+ current (IA) plays an active role in neuronal action potential firing and may contribute to Regulate the frequency of day and night discharge. During electrophysiological recordings of IA, tetraethylammonium (TEA) is frequently used to suppress delayed rectifier K+ current (IDR).

What does TEA do to action potentials?

TEA increases the duration of action potentials (Schmidt & Stampfli, 1966) Activation of delayed rectifier K+ channels by blocking depolarization in the conjunctival membrane.

Which channels does tetraethylammonium block?

Tetraethylammonium ion (TEA; Et4N+) and 4-aminopyridine (Figure 2.7) block Certain voltage-operated potassium channels in nerves and other excitable membranes (Table 2.1).

What is TTX bound to?

Tetrodotoxin (TTX) is a potent toxin that specifically binds voltage-gated sodium channel. TTX binding physically blocks the flow of sodium ions through the channel, thereby preventing the generation and propagation of action potentials (APs).

What channel does TEA block?

Tetraethylammonium (TEA) Pass potassium channel from both sides of the membrane in a voltage-dependent manner. Here, we demonstrate the structural basis for TEA blockade by co-crystallizing the prokaryotic potassium channel KcsA with two selective TEA analogs.

Does tea affect resting membrane potential?

Note that in the presence of TEA, No change in resting potential. The channels in the membrane that impart a resting potential to the cell are different from the channels that are opened by voltage. … TEA only affects voltage-dependent changes in K+ permeability.
